Handy Hoppers is a 2-vs.-2 minigame found in Mario Party 5. Its name is a pun on the phrase "handy helpers."
Gameplay
The goal of the minigame is to jump over the bar as many times as possible. One player rotates a lever, making the hands holding the bar rotate. The other player must jump this bar as it passes below them. The point is to rotate it fast but not extremely fast so the player jumping it can jump in time. The team with more points at the end of the minigame wins. If both teams have the same number of points, the minigame ends in a draw.
This minigame takes place on a giant gloved hand (that looks similar to Master Hand), with a blue sky and a rainbow in the background. Holding the bar are two hands wearing white gloves. There are more of these hands over the screen. The player who is jumping is standing on a hand-shaped carpet with a star in the middle. Everything for the players to the left is red, while the others receive their traditional blue.
